Title:
HEAT TREATMENT FOR METAL MATRIX COMPOSITE MATERIAL

Abstract:

PURPOSE: To relieve thermal stress and to increase the strength of a metal matrix composite material as a whole by performing cooling treatment down to a specific temp. at the time of heat treatment of a metal matrix composite material.

CONSTITUTION: A process, where cooling is done down to low temp. at least once, is added to the heat treatment process for a metal matrix composite material where metal (alloy) is used as matrix and ceramics and metal are used as reinforcement. It is preferable to regulate the cooling temp. to ≤0°C. Because thermal stress is relieved by the cooling, a crystallographical dislocation is generated in the matrix of the metal matrix composite material and the matrix is strengthened, and consequently, the whole metal matrix composite material is also strengthened and superior strength characteristics can be obtained. In this cooling process, the rate of change in temp. in a cooling stage down to a specific temp. is made dissimilar to that in a subsequent temp. rise stage, by which dislocation density increased by cooling is moved in the direction of dislocation source in the temp. rise stage to prevent the dissipation of the dislocation density in the interface between the reinforcement and the matrix.
